📋 Description

• Design, develop, implement, and maintain Epic Bridges interfaces and integration solutions • Support HL7 real-time and conversion interfaces between Epic and ancillary healthcare systems • Troubleshoot interface issues, data discrepancies, transmission failures, and workflow interruptions • Partner with clinical, operational, vendor, and technical teams to support interoperability initiatives • Perform interface testing, validation, upgrades, and change management activities • Support post–Epic go-live stabilization and ongoing optimization efforts • Monitor interface performance and proactively address integration issues • Participate in workflow analysis and recommend technical improvements to enhance operational efficiency • Maintain interface documentation, support procedures, and technical specifications • Assist with production support, issue escalation, and root cause analysis activities • Ensure adherence to organizational integration standards, security policies, and ITIL best practices

🎯 Requirements

•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field, or equivalent combination of education and experience • Minimum 4 years of interface development experience • Minimum 2 years of interface development experience within an Epic environment • Minimum 2 years of hands-on Epic Bridges experience • Experience designing, building, and supporting HL7 real-time interfaces • Epic certification in Interface Development required • Strong troubleshooting, integration, and workflow optimization experience • Experience collaborating with cross-functional technical, operational, and clinical teams • Strong understanding of healthcare interoperability standards and integration methodologies

🏖️ Benefits

• Salary based on experience $90,000 - $130,000
